If no, please tell us why you are now interested in writing it and why you haven?t done so before.

    *buzz* What is ?yes?, Alex?

    I?ve written three multi-post completely humor fics. The first was the second story I posted here, and had about one reader I think. It wasn?t very good. The second was one of my favorite plot bunnies I?ve ever had (the real Boushh hunts down Leia for framing him), and had good reception. Same with Braken Starblaster, Space Attorney: The Dark Darkness, apparently. :p Thanks and shout-out to readers for the mentions above by the way! [:D]

    I really enjoy making people laugh. Those replies where a reader points out something in my post that struck them as funny, it?s one of my favorite compliments to get. ?Serious? fic or comedy, doesn?t matter. Makes me warm ?n? fuzzy. :D Matter of fact, writing something without humor is nigh impossible for me. I can only sustain an absolutely pitch black tone for a post or two. Personally, I don?t see any reason I should. Humor is a huge part of life, and can be included without compromising the dramatic weight of a story. In fact, I think the right kind of humor can even enhance a tragic section of prose.
